You correct your selection through the g.a.s.t. portal before your registration closes. There is currently no confirmed process to switch modules after the exam date itself, so the window to fix a mistake is limited.

Fixing It Before Registration Closes

As long as your registration window is still open, you can change your module choice in the g.a.s.t. portal. Once the exam date passes, there is no confirmed route to correct it, so treat the open window as your only reliable opportunity.

When You Are Unsure Which Module Applies

If you are unsure which module applies to you, particularly for borderline degrees like B.Sc. Statistics, integrated MBAs, or dual-major programs, get written confirmation from APS India or directly from your target program before registering rather than guessing based on subject name overlap.

My Advice

Double-check your module selection immediately after registering, not weeks later. If something looks wrong, fix it through the portal right away while your registration window is still open; waiting until closer to the exam date removes your ability to correct it at all.
